to drive, the sad reality is that it was merely a great muscle car that could<br />
go fast in a straight line and nothing else. Today’s Corvette clocks in a<br />
3.3sec 0-100kph time courtesy of a 6.2-liter supercharged V8. This motor,<br />
along with the all-wheel drivetrain, can match the Aventador’s 690hp<br />
6.5-liter V12 with its own 650 horses.<br />
Sure, the century run may be down by 0.4sec versus the bull, but the<br />
Vette can now hold its own around the corners. That’s something that<br />
could never be said of Chevys (or any American muscle car) of old.<br />
Moreover, you can even specify a plethora of go-fast and gee-whiz gizmos<br />
to make it run even better. That’s in addition to the already sophisticated<br />
all-wheel-drive system, carbon-fiber body, and a look that is as droolworthy<br />
as the hottest cars on the planet.<br />
